Conditions
• If
the call is transferred to the incoming call distribution group and is handled by the Queuing Time
Table:
Transfer Recall will not occur even if the Transfer Recall time expires.
• Manual Queue Redirection
It is possible to redirect the longest waiting call in a queue to the overflow destination by pressing the
Hurry-up button. (If the call is already ringing at an extension, it will not be redirected.) This feature is also
known as Hurry-up Transfer.
• Hurry-up Button
A flexible button can be customised as the Hurry-up button. The number of calls queuing before Manual
Queue Redirection may be performed is programmable. The button shows the current status as follows:
Light Pattern Calls in the Waiting Queue
Off No queued call
Red on At or under the assigned number for Hurry-up
Rapid red flashing Over the assigned number for Hurry-up
